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
107491 848854 11708232 288 119060
98951144174 05
98951144174 05
52 58920515 3318868
All about undefined
Interested in learning more?
98951144174 05
52 58920515 3318868
See more
80 190308447
957945994 52 955 843
See more
7216010 351
506933387 675935 376 56
See more